Subject Description | This subject is designed as an introduction to contemporary spoken and written Vietnamese. No previous knowledge of the language is presumed. Students who complete the subject should have an understanding of the basic level of syntactic patterns, vocabulary for practical oral communication and phonology, and an understanding of Vietnamese culture and society. |
Assessment | A book review of 1500 words, an assignment of 1500 words, a 1-hour written test, and a 2-hour oral exam. Students must attend at least 70% of classes to be eligible for assessment. |
